Jitan - Bundwan, Purulia

Jitan is a village situated in the Bundwan subdivision of Purulia district, West Bengal. It is located approximately 3.4 km from Bandwan and around 48.6 km from Purulia. Supudih serves as the Gram Panchayat for Jitan village.

As per Census 2011, the village code of Jitan is 332358. The village covers a total geographical area of 195.06 hectares and falls under the 723129 pincode. Tata is the nearest town, located about 57 km away.

Jitan village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head.

Population of Jitan

As per Census 2011, Jitan village has a total population of 859 people, consisting of 437 males and 422 females. The village has 176 households and a sex ratio of 965 females per 1,000 males. There are 108 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 435 literate and 424 illiterate residents. Additionally, 17 people belong to Scheduled Caste (SC) communities and 182 to Scheduled Tribe (ST) communities.

Transport and Connectivity of Jitan

Public transport facilities are available within 5-10 km of the Jitan. The nearest railway station is Asanboni, while the nearest airport is Sonari Airport, situated at an approximate aerial distance of 28.5 km.

In addition to basic transport facilities, distances and travel times help define overall connectivity. The road distance from Tata to Jitan is about 57 km, with a usual travel time of around ~1.6 hours. Similarly, the road distance from Purulia to Jitan is about 48.6 km, with the usual travel time around ~1.4 hours. Actual travel time may vary depending on road conditions and mode of transport.
